Abstract

A Reconfigurable ReflectArray (RRA) structure includes a P-Intrinsic-N (P-I-N) diode and a metal circuit. The metal circuit includes a first metal member and a second metal member. The first metal member is coupled to one end of the P-I-N diode. The second metal member is coupled to another end of the P-I-N diode. One of the first metal member and the second metal member includes a first radiating portion and a second radiating portion. The first radiating portion is located between the P-I-N diode and the second radiating portion. The first radiating portion has a first length. The second radiating portion has a second length. The first length is different from the second length.
